The Seaford train station is a small, yet efficiently equipped station, catering to the essential needs of its passengers. Operating under the Southern Railway network, the ticket office opens early at 06:10 and closes at 19:35 from Monday to Saturday. On Sundays, the hours are slightly shorter, beginning at 08:25 and ending at 16:00. For those preferring to manage their travel on the go, accessible ticket machines are available, designed to accommodate users with disabilities and to facilitate the purchase and collection of tickets, including those purchased online. Smartcard validators are also on hand for a seamless commute.
Providing support and assistance, the station is equipped with a Help Point, departure screens, and regular staff announcements to keep you informed. Moreover, for those requiring additional support, the entire station supports step-free access, ensuring ease of movement throughout. Assistance can be pre-booked to ensure that your travel is as comfortable and smooth as possible, allowing you to focus on the excitement of your journey.
Transportation from Seaford (Sussex) station extends beyond the train lines. A convenient taxi rank sits just outside the station entrance, ready to whisk you away to your next destination. For those looking into alternative routes or dealing with potential service disruptions, the station provides information on rail replacement services. Also, local bus services offer further travel options to neighboring towns and attractions, ensuring you are well connected, regardless of the direction you choose for your next adventure.

Corkickle Station offers essential amenities for passengers. While the station does not have a staffed ticket office, it features ticket machines for convenient online collections, and these machines are accessible to all passengers. Although there are no customer help points or staff assistance, assistance can be requested upon train arrival, assuring support for those who may need it. Although lacking in conventional facilities such as waiting rooms or refreshment kiosks, Corkickle prides itself on accessibility—providing step-free access and scooter-friendly navigation.
Corkickle is more than just a train station; it's a hub that connects you to various modes of transport. Rail replacement services conveniently pick up and drop off passengers at the station's front on Station Road, ensuring seamless travel even during disruptions. Taxis are also easily managed through platforms like Cab4You, making your journey to and from the station stress-free. While bicycle hire isn't available directly at the station, consider nearby services for a leisurely pedal around the scenic surroundings.
